Understanding the Class C License

A Class C driving license is a type of commercial driver's license (CDL) that is particularly designed for chauffeurs who operate automobiles that do not fall under the Class A or Class B categories. These cars consist of:

  • School buses
  • Traveler buses
  • Large vans
  • Some trucks with dangerous products recommendations

The Class C license is necessary for people who want to drive these types of vehicles for a living or for personal usage. It is particularly important for those who work in transport, tourist, and delivery services.

Steps to Obtain a Class C Driving License

  1. Satisfy the Eligibility Requirements

    • Age: You must be at least 18 years old to request a Class C license. Nevertheless, to drive throughout state lines, you need to be 21 years old.
    • Residency: You should be a legal homeowner of the state where you are obtaining the license.
    • Basic Driving Skills: You need to have a legitimate non-commercial driver's license and a clean driving record.
    • Medical Certification: You need to pass a Department of Transportation (DOT) medical examination to ensure you are fit to operate an industrial vehicle.
  2. Research Study the CDL Manual

    • Each state provides a CDL handbook that details the rules, regulations, and safe driving practices for commercial lorries. It is vital to study this handbook thoroughly to prepare for the written test.
  3. Take the Written Test

    • The composed test covers different subjects, including lorry examination, standard control, and safe driving practices. You will also need to pass any additional recommendations required for the specific kind of car you wish to drive. Typical recommendations consist of:
      • Hazardous Materials (H): Required if you will be carrying dangerous products.
      • Passenger (P): Required if you will be driving an automobile developed to bring 16 or more guests.
      • School Bus (S): Required if you will be driving a school bus.
  4. Obtain a Commercial Learner's Permit (CLP)

    • After passing the written test, you will get a Commercial Learner's Permit (CLP). This license enables you to practice driving business automobiles under the guidance of a licensed commercial driver.
    • Practice Hours: You must hold the CLP for at least 14 days and log at least 50 hours of practice driving before you can take the skills test.
  5. Pass the Skills Test

    • The abilities test includes three parts:
      • Pre-Trip Inspection: You will be needed to examine the vehicle to ensure it is safe to operate.
      • Standard Controls: This test examines your ability to control the vehicle in numerous situations, including beginning, stopping, and maneuvering.
      • Road Test: You will drive the car on the roadway to demonstrate your capability to operate it safely in traffic.
  6. Use for the Class C License

    • As soon as you have passed the abilities test, you can look for your Class C driving license. You will require to offer the following files:
      • Proof of identity (driver's license, passport)
      • Proof of residency (utility bill, lease contract)
      • Proof of Social Security number (Social Security card)
      • Medical certification card
      • CLP (if relevant)
    • Fees: There will be a fee for the license application, which varies by state.
  7. Maintain Your License

    • Renewal: Your Class C license need to be restored periodically, usually every couple of years. The renewal process and charges vary by state.
    • Background Checks: Some states require periodic background checks, specifically if you have specific endorsements like the Hazardous Materials recommendation.
    • Continuing Education: To keep your license, you may require to finish continuing education courses, particularly if you have endorsements.

Frequently asked questions About Obtaining a Class C Driving License

Q: How long does it require to get a Class C driving license?A: The procedure can take a few weeks to a couple of months, depending on your preparation and the schedule of test slots. Here's a breakdown:

  • Written Test: Can be taken as quickly as you are ready.
  • CLP Practice: Minimum of 14 days.
  • Abilities Test: Schedule as quickly as you feel great and meet the practice requirements.
  • License Issuance: Immediate upon passing the skills test, but the real card might take a few weeks to get here by mail.

Q: What is the distinction between a Class C license and a non-commercial Class D license?A: A Class C license is a commercial driver's license that allows you to operate specific kinds of commercial vehicles. A non-commercial Class D license is a basic driver's license that permits you to drive personal vehicles, such as cars and trucks and small trucks. The Class C license has more strict requirements, consisting of a DOT medical examination and additional recommendations.

Q: Can I use my Class C license to drive throughout state lines?A: Yes, however to drive throughout state lines, you must be at least 21 years old and adhere to federal regulations, such as having a Medical Examiner's Certificate and a satisfying medical card.

Q: Do I require to take a driving school course to get a Class C license?A: While it is not obligatory, taking a driving school course can significantly improve your opportunities of passing the skills test. Driving schools offer hands-on training and acquaint you with the specific requirements and driving strategies needed for commercial vehicles.

Q: What are the effects of having a suspended Class C license?A: If your Class C license is suspended, you will not be enabled to operate commercial lorries throughout the suspension period. This can have serious ramifications for your employment and might require you to complete additional training or pay fines before your license is renewed.

Q: Can I drive a Class A or Class B car with a Class C license?A: No, a Class C license only permits you to operate cars that meet the Class C requirements. To drive Class A or Class B automobiles, you will need to acquire the matching CDL.

Q: Are there particular recommendations I need to add to my Class C license?A: Yes, if you prepare to transport hazardous materials, drive a vehicle with more than 15 travelers, or run a school bus, you will require to include the suitable endorsements. Each endorsement requires a different written test and, in many cases, an abilities test.

Q: What are the charges for running a commercial automobile without a legitimate Class C license?A: Operating a business car without a legitimate Class C license can lead to fines, license suspension, and even legal action. It is vital to ensure you have the appropriate license and recommendations before running an industrial car.
